Experiencing occasional anxiety is a normal part of life. However, people with anxiety disorders frequently have intense, excessive and persistent worry and fear about everyday situations. Trauma.Children who endured abuse or trauma or witnessed traumatic events are at higher risk of … See more The causes of anxiety disorders aren't fully understood. Life experiences such as traumatic events appear to trigger anxiety disorders in people who are already prone to anxiety. Inherited traits also can be a factor. Anxiety is telling us that we care about the future and want it to turn out a certain way.
